Default I can safely say our first offensive play in 2007 will be better than last year's

I can still remember the blindside blitz from a hard hitting Takeo Spikes that Brady took on the very first play on offense in 2006 resulting in a TD for the bills as London Fletcher picked up the loose ball and ran 12 yards into the end zone within 7 seconds of the 1st quarter,Bet it will be a better result this year - can't possibly be worse, right?

The fact that Brady got hit from a super hard hitting LB like Takeo Spikes made me hold my breath for a few seconds,Matt Light I believe was the lineman that Spikes went by untouched to the QB
